PRIMARY PURPOSE

Provides bed management to all patients presenting to Parkland and serves as an information resource for external facilities, patient, patient families, nursing units and physicians to facilitate the movement of patients through the hospital in accordance with Parkland policies and procedures. Works in conjunction with healthcare teams to coordinate the transfer of patients within the institution and inter-facility, utilizing sound knowledge of Bed Access Management (BAM) departmental and PHHS policies and procedures as well as in-depth analysis and use of individual judgment.

MINIMUM SPECIFICATIONS
Education: Must be a graduate of an accredited school of Nursing. Prefer Bachelor of Science in Nursing.

Experience:
- Must have recent acute care experience.
- Must have two years of medical/surgical nursing experience.
- Prefer two years nursing experience to include critical care experience.

Equivalent Experience:
- May have an equivalent combination of education or experience to substitute for the above requirements.

Certification/Registration/Licensure:
- Must have current, valid RN license or temporary RN license with the Texas Board of Nursing; or, valid Compact RN license.
- Must maintain current healthcare provider CPR course completion card. from one of the following:

  • American Heart Association
  • American Red Cross Rescuer
  • Military Training Network.

Skills or Special Abilities:
- Provides care to assigned patient population in accordance with the current State of Texas Nursing Practice Act, established protocols, multidisciplinary plan of care, and clinical area specific standards.
- Must be able to apply knowledge of nursing, patient conditions, and hospital conditions into admitting, transferring, and monitoring functions.
- Must be able to demonstrate ability to use independent judgment in resolving issues within established guidelines.
- Must be able to communicate/collaborate effectively with Parkland staff, physicians, patients and patient families.
- Must be able to demonstrate patient-centered/patient-valued behaviors.
- Must be able to prioritize bed assignments in a fast-paced environment.
- Must be able to demonstrate a working knowledge of specific patient populations, and be able to demonstrate knowledge of disease processes affecting this group.
- Must be able to demonstrate a strong knowledge of basic skills for computer software and of PC operations.
- Must be able to demonstrate a working knowledge of the laws and regulations governing Medicare, Medicaid and community-based funding sources.
- Must be self-directed and capable of priority setting and problem solving.
- Must be able to handle potentially stressful situations and multiple tasks simultaneously.
